DSM Neocryl XK-14 is a waterborne acrylic copolymer emulsion in the Neocryl XK series, designed for multi-substrate universal coatings of plastic, wood and metal, with 40% solid content, pH 8.6, viscosity 50 mPa.s (25℃) and minimum film-forming temperature 33℃. It has excellent water and chemical resistance, good leveling and transparency, outstanding anti-blocking property, and excellent adhesion to flexible PVC

| Product Model | Neocryl XK-14 |
| Brand | DSM |
| Chemical Type | Waterborne Acrylic Copolymer Emulsion |
| Appearance | Milky-White Liquid |
| Solid Content | 40 % |
| pH Value | 8.6 |
| Viscosity (25℃) | 50 mPa·s |
| Minimum Film-Forming Temperature | 33 ℃ |
| Density (25℃) | Approx. 1.02 g/cm³ |
